1296

John Balliol11 July 1296

Brechin · Warfare / England War

John Balliol renounces his crown & Kingdom in front of Edward I. At Brechin Edward subjected John to the humiliation of having his royal regalia stripped from him

1307

Robert I the Bruce1307

Warfare / England War

A series of successful campaigns against the Comyns and their allies leaves Roert I the Bruce in control of most of Scotland

1309

Robert I the Bruce1309

Warfare / England War

Robert I the Bruce is recognized as sole ruler by the French King and despite his earlier excommunication, even receives the support of the Scottish Church

1311

Robert I the Bruce1311

Warfare / England War

Robert I the Bruce drives out the English garrisons in all their Scottish strongholds except Stirling and invades northern England
